现在的位置: 首页 > 综合 > 正文

使用Win2003 R2实现对文件夹的限额

2018年06月06日 ⁄ 综合 ⁄ 共 1965字 ⁄ 字号 评论关闭

使用过Windows系统的管理员都会或多或少地接触Windows的磁盘限额功能.有关磁盘限额的好处及实用价值我就不说太多了,如果你对这个不了解的话可以去问下Google.在Windows 2003 R2版本之前,它的限额仅仅只是针对整个独立的分区有效,如果要针对某个用户的文件夹进行限额操作的话就无能为力了.当然,Linux下的限额管理功能早就有了,但是复杂的操作以及不太友好的报表对大众用户来说是一种考验.

  我们使用Win2003 R2针对限额操作到底可以实现哪些功能呢?我就我自已感兴趣的地方谈一下自己的感受:可以针对单独的文件夹进行限额;可以自定义限额的模板;阻止自定义类型的文件存放到服务器;详细的报表功能(可以针对用户,文件夹,文件的大小,文件创建的时间等).当然,功能还有很多,这里就不一一列举,感到恐惧兴趣的话可以去查看相关的资料.我这里用的版本是Win2003 R2英文版,如图:
  正常情况下安装介质一共有两张光盘,其中第一张是正常的Win2003+SP1的光盘,而第二张光盘上则为新增加的R2的功能盘.
  Windows的安装比较简单,要注意的是在安装时记得选取安装"东亚语言",不然显示中文会出现乱码的情况,当然也可以在系统安装完成后再添加.

  
  系统安装完成后,插入第二张盘安装我们所需的功能,这里我设定了四个部门,ACC,ADM,MKT,IT分别代表财务部,行政部,市场部和IT部门.也许有人会问为什么用这些代号来表示各部门,其实我在以前写的一篇目文章中也有提到( http://waringid.blog.51cto.com/65148/73387),它在使用Exchange作为内部邮件通讯的企业中特别有用,可以将同一个部门的所有用户显示在一起;用户可以看到显示名;这种方式在超过300个用户的公司中优势才会体现,因为不可能所有人都记得整个公司用户的邮件地址,而通过Outlook的全球地址薄可以手工选择.每个文件夹下分为安全文件夹,个人文件夹及部门公用文件夹.所实现的要求如下:各部门人员的默认权限是在部门公用下有读写权限;在个人文件夹下有列目录权限;安全文件夹是部门经理或是高层人员专用文件夹;部门公用文件夹允许授权其它部门的人员只读访问;个人文件夹针对本部门特定用户指定读写权限,其宽人地权访问;权限的控制通过相应的授权组实现.如果你对组不太明白的话,可以参考: http://waringid.blog.51cto.com/65148/53310.安装完成及建立相关目录后的结果如下:

  
  定义阻止用户存放的文件类型.
  为了使服务器的空间更有效的应用,应阻止用户存放与工作无关的文件或程序.例如:音频视频文件;可执行档;网页相关文件等.这些都可以自定义.这里要说明的是这种方式只对检测文件的扩展名,如果更改了扩展名可能就起不到这个效果了.当然,并不是Microsoft没有技术做好这些,而且它推出的这项功能和它的合作伙伴Symantec相关的软件冲突( http://www.symantec.com/zh/cn/business/products/index.jsp),如果你不清楚Microsoft和Symantec之间的合作事项,你可以在命令行中输入"ntbackup",然后再查看"关于"就明白了.
  
  应用后如果存入或新建被阻止类型的文件,将会出现下面的提示:
  
  现在可以对相应的文件夹进行限额操作了,为了更好的显示测试结果,我定义的限额策略是这样的:部门文件夹:60M;部门公用文件夹:30M;部门安全文件夹:10M;个人文件夹:5M;特别设定:50M.定义好后结果如下图所示:
  
  设定完成后可以在相应文件夹下建立足够大小的文件来测试文件夹的限额.在Linux下有相关的命令来建立指定大小的文件,虽然在Windows下没有相关的命令,但我们可以通过Debug这个指令来建立相应大小的文件.假设我们要建立4M的文件,可以通过以下指令:
debug
rcx
0000
rbx
0040
n 4M
w
q
这样就可以在当前目录下建立大小为4M的文件了,当然,可以通过批处理的方式完成,这个就留给大家去做吧.测试后的图片如下:
  
  相应的报表功能也是它的一大特色,在这里你可以针对指定的目录或是指定的用户,甚至是指定文件建立的时间或是访问的次数.下图是建立相应的报表:
  相应的报如下:
  怎么样,是不是觉得还可以呢?当然,做完这些仅仅只是一部份,真正要完成一个应用的话还有很多方面的东西要补充.但是我觉得这篇文章太长了,还有其它的留给下一篇文章.在下一篇文章中将会结合AD一起实施客户端对服务器的访问,当然,下一篇会以这篇文章为基础.那么下一篇文章将会涉及到DFS及组策略的应用等.有时间再更新吧.

抱歉!评论已关闭.